WebJun 24, 2024 · Flanders ( Dutch: Vlaanderen) [1] is the Dutch -speaking northern part of Belgium. It is wedged between the North Sea and the Netherlands in the north and Wallonia and France in the south. This … Dutch is the majority language in northern Belgium, being spoken natively by three-fifths of the population of Belgium. It is one of the three national languages of Belgium, together with French and German, and is the only official language of the Flemish Region. The various Dutch dialects spoken in Belgium contain a number of lexical and a few grammatical features which distinguish them from Standard Dutch. WebFlanders, the northern, Dutch-speaking part of Belgium, is experiencing growing intra- and interlingual diversity. On the intralingual level, Tussentaal ("in-between-language") has emerged as a cluster of intermediate varieties between the Flemish dialects and Standard Dutch, gradually becoming "the" colloquial language. WebBelgium has three official languages: Dutch, French and German. Flanders, the northern part of Belgium, is Dutch-speaking; Wallonia, the southern part of Belgium, is French-speaking ; In the east of Belgium, there is a small German-speaking community (70 000 inhabitants) Brussels, the capital, is officially Dutch-French bilingual.
